I needed to stay in Brussels for one night between flights, and wanted a hotel close to Grand Place and the railway station.||I arrived at the hotel at 11 am, and, unsurprisingly, my room was not ready. The friendly receptionist held my luggage and informed me of the official check-in time at 2 pm. however, when I got back at 1:25, the room was ready and I was able to check in. I needed to pay a city tax of 4.25 EUR. Check-out would be at 11 am.||I had booked a single room, and it was very small but adequate for a one-night stay. The room was clean and fresh and seemed recently renovated. There was a comfortable but narrow bed, only 90 cm wide, and a socket by the bed for charging your devices. In addition, there was a luggage rack, a small desk and a chair as well as a safe, a fridge and a 0.5 L water bottle. Wifi was free, fast, unlimited, reliable and very easy to use.||The bathroom was minuscule, the size of a closet really, and came with a handheld shower. Water pressure was good, but it took several minutes for the water to become hot and once it had warmed up, the temperature kept changing unexpectedly, which was not very nice. The sink was too small and thus impractical. Amenities included wall-mounted containers of hand soap, shower gel and shampoo.||The toilet was in a separate minuscule closet, and as it was unheated, it was freezing cold, especially the stone floor.||Buffet breakfast, 18 euros, was served in the downstairs restaurant from 7 to 10:30. I did not try it. Otherwise, the restaurant serves Pakistani food for lunch and dinner. There are several restaurants and cafés nearby.||Reception is open 24/7 and I found all the receptionists I interacted with friendly and fluent in English. I needed to have a boarding pass printed, and that was swiftly taken care of.||The hotel enjoys a very central location, two blocks from Grand Place, a ten-minute walk from the central railway station (with an efficient train connection to the airport). There is a Carrefour supermarket on the next block, open daily from 7 am to 11 pm.||Booking early, I paid 94 euros for my one-night stay, which I suppose was more or less what the hotel was worth. However, as my stay approached, the prices went up significantly – Brussels seems to be full of weekend tourists in December. This hotel is a Pakistan family run hotel. It is close to most of the attractions and good food.
However, this hotel definitely need some renovations as most of the things are quite old and spoilt.
There’s no drop off point for Uber or Bolt to stop in front of hotel. You need to walk from the drop off point 100-200m away. Brussels central station is around 10 mins on feet without luggage and 15 mins with luggage. Don’t try to pull your luggages and walk back from Brussels Central Station as the road was full of huge rocks and very uneven. My luggage wheel spoilt while I was trying to do so. Use an Uber or taxi instead. There’s no shelter from the station to this hotel. Good luck if it’s raining.
All the room types I stayed have no aircon, only small standing fans. Make sure you have an AC room during summer.
During these 2 stays, the warmers were not functioning at all, if it’s winter, I bet the room will be freezing cold.
Night time, if you open the window to ventilate, you might be disturbed with either the oily smell from kitchen or noise from dog barking or people shouting outside.
During our first stay in triple room, the toilet bowl was broken. We need to go to the restaurant downstairs to use the toilet. Luckily during the second stay in double room, the toilet bowl can be used. Showering is a hassle as there’s only small piece of glass blocking the water from dripping out. Both times, the toilet were like flood after we showered.
The luggage storage is only free the day of your stay and the day you check out. In between, it will be 20€/ pay. Guess it is because of the space constrained?
Breakfast was good and they provided sufficient stuffs that’s Halal.
Highlight of the stay, the hotel staffs were quite attentive to our needs and very friendly. I left my converter during my first stay and they managed to keep until 2nd visit back there.
